Jacqueline left a voice message on the Family Life Behind Bars phone line about how traumatic it was for her and her family when she was incarcerated because of her substance abuse problems.

She is now involved in a program, Connecticut Pardon Team, that helps former inmates file their pardons applications. You can contact the non-profit organization at 1-860-823-1571.
